机器人编程是什么语言的应用

fiy 其他 7

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    机器人编程可以使用多种编程语言来实现。以下是几种常见的机器人编程语言应用:

    1. C/C++:C/C++是一种高级编程语言,广泛用于机器人编程领域。C/C++语言具有高效性和可移植性,可以直接控制硬件设备,适用于实时控制和底层开发。

    2. Python:Python是一种简洁而易于学习的编程语言,也是机器人编程中常用的语言之一。Python具有丰富的库和工具,能够快速实现机器人的各种功能,如图像处理、机器学习和自然语言处理等。

    3. MATLAB:MATLAB是一种专业的数学和工程计算软件,也可以用于机器人编程。MATLAB提供了丰富的工具箱和函数,可用于控制系统设计、运动规划和仿真等。

    4. ROS:ROS(Robot Operating System)是一个用于机器人开发的开源平台,支持多种编程语言,如C++、Python和Java等。ROS提供了一套强大的工具和库,用于机器人的感知、控制和导航等。

    5. LabVIEW:LabVIEW是一种基于图形化编程的开发环境,广泛应用于机器人编程和自动化控制领域。LabVIEW可以通过拖拽和连接图形化模块来构建机器人应用程序,简化了编程的复杂性。

    总而言之,机器人编程可以使用多种编程语言来实现,选择合适的编程语言取决于具体的应用场景和需求。不同的编程语言有不同的特点和优势,开发人员可以根据自己的经验和需求选择适合的语言进行机器人编程。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    机器人编程可以使用多种不同的编程语言进行应用。以下是几种常用的机器人编程语言:

    1. Python:Python是一种简单易学的编程语言,广泛应用于机器人编程领域。它具有丰富的库和工具,可以用于控制机器人的各种功能和行为。Python还支持ROS(机器人操作系统),这是一个开源的机器人软件平台,可以帮助开发人员更方便地构建机器人应用程序。

    2. C++:C++是一种高级编程语言,被广泛用于机器人编程。它具有较高的执行效率和灵活性,可以用于开发复杂的机器人系统。许多机器人操作系统和框架(如ROS)都使用C++作为其主要编程语言。

    3. Java:Java是一种面向对象的编程语言,也被广泛应用于机器人编程。它具有强大的跨平台性能和丰富的库,可以用于开发各种机器人应用程序。Java还支持ROS和其他机器人框架。

    4. MATLAB:MATLAB是一种数值计算和数据可视化的编程语言,也用于机器人编程。它提供了丰富的工具箱和函数,可以用于机器人动力学建模、路径规划、运动控制等方面。

    5. Blockly:Blockly是一种基于图形化编程的语言,特别适用于初学者和非专业人士。它使用可拖拽的积木块来创建程序,可以轻松地构建简单的机器人应用。

    这些只是机器人编程的一些常用语言,实际上还有许多其他编程语言可以用于机器人编程,如JavaScript、Lua等。选择哪种编程语言取决于机器人的需求、开发人员的熟练程度和项目的要求。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    机器人编程可以使用多种不同的编程语言进行应用。下面将介绍几种常用的机器人编程语言及其应用。

    1. Python:
      Python是一种高级编程语言,被广泛用于机器人编程。它具有简洁、易读、易学的特点,适合初学者使用。Python可以用于编写机器人的控制程序,实现机器人的基本功能,如移动、感知、决策等。此外,Python还有许多机器人相关的库和框架,如ROS(机器人操作系统),可以帮助开发者更方便地构建机器人应用。

    2. C++:
      C++是一种通用的高级编程语言,也广泛应用于机器人编程。C++具有高效、灵活的特点,适合对机器人性能要求较高的应用场景。许多机器人操作系统和框架,如ROS和ROS 2.0,都使用C++作为主要的开发语言。C++可以用于编写机器人的底层驱动程序、图像处理算法、运动控制算法等。

    3. MATLAB:
      MATLAB是一种专业的数学软件,也可用于机器人编程。它具有强大的数学计算和数据处理能力,适合用于机器人的建模、仿真、控制等方面。MATLAB提供了许多机器人工具箱,包括机器人运动学、动力学、路径规划等模块,可以帮助开发者快速实现机器人应用。

    4. Java:
      Java是一种跨平台的面向对象编程语言,也可用于机器人编程。Java具有良好的可移植性和扩展性,适合用于开发大型、复杂的机器人应用。许多机器人操作系统和控制系统,如Aria和Player/Stage,都使用Java作为开发语言。Java可以用于编写机器人的控制程序、图形用户界面等。

    除了以上几种常用的机器人编程语言,还有其他一些语言也可以用于机器人编程,如Lua、JavaScript、ROS等。选择合适的编程语言取决于具体的应用需求、开发经验和团队技术能力等因素。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部